How Do Battery Types Affect Performance and Longevity?
Battery types affect performance and longevity by influencing energy storage capacity, discharge rates, and response to charging cycles. Each battery type has unique characteristics that contribute to its overall efficiency and lifespan.
-
Lithium-Ion Batteries: These batteries provide a high energy density. They can store a large amount of energy in a relatively small space. Studies show that they can maintain up to 80% of their original capacity after 500 to 800 charge cycles (Nagaoka et al., 2020).
-
Nickel-Metal Hydride (NiMH) Batteries: NiMH batteries have a moderate energy density compared to lithium-ion batteries. They are less efficient, typically losing about 20-30% of their capacity after 500 charge cycles (Huang et al., 2019). However, they perform well under different temperatures.
-
Lead-Acid Batteries: Lead-acid batteries are widely used for larger applications. They have a lower energy density and a limited cycle life, generally around 300-500 cycles (Nazari et al., 2021). They require maintenance and can suffer from sulfation if not used properly.
-
Energy Discharge Rates: The type of battery affects how quickly it releases energy. Lithium-ion batteries provide faster discharge rates, which can enhance device performance, particularly in power-intensive applications.
-
Charging Cycles: Each battery type responds differently to charging cycles. Lithium-ion batteries experience less degradation after multiple cycles, while lead-acid batteries tend to deteriorate more quickly.
-
Temperature Sensitivity: Battery performance can vary with temperature. Lithium-ion batteries can operate efficiently in a wider temperature range than NiMH or lead-acid batteries.
-
Self-Discharge Rates: The self-discharge rate indicates how quickly a battery loses charge when not in use. Lithium-ion batteries have a low self-discharge rate, retaining charge for longer periods, while NiMH batteries lose charge relatively quickly.
Understanding the attributes of different battery types helps users select the right battery for their specific needs, balancing performance and longevity for optimal use.
What Safety Features Should a Replacement Battery for Dyson SV10 Have?
When selecting a replacement battery for the Dyson SV10, specific safety features are essential for optimal performance and user safety.
- Overcharge protection
- Overcurrent protection
- Short-circuit protection
- Temperature control
- Fire-resistant materials
- Certification marks (e.g., CE, UL)
These points outline the necessary safety features. Now let’s delve deeper into each of these aspects for a better understanding.
-
Overcharge Protection: Overcharge protection in a replacement battery prevents the battery from charging beyond its maximum capacity. This feature is vital as overcharging can lead to battery damage or even fires. High-quality batteries include circuitry that halts charging when the battery reaches full capacity.
-
Overcurrent Protection: Overcurrent protection safeguards against excessive current flowing through the battery. It can prevent overheating and damage, ensuring the device operates safely. This protection is often achieved through internal fuses or specialized circuits.
-
Short-Circuit Protection: Short-circuit protection is crucial for preventing accidental shorts that can cause significant harm. This feature enables the battery to disconnect from the circuit in case of a short, thus reducing the risk of fire or damage. Many modern batteries have built-in safety mechanisms to cut power during a short circuit.
-
Temperature Control: Temperature control features monitor and manage the battery’s temperature during operation and charging. Excess heat can reduce battery life and pose safety hazards. Advanced batteries are equipped with thermal sensors that automatically reduce charging current if overheating is detected.
-
Fire-Resistant Materials: Fire-resistant materials enhance the safety of replacement batteries. These materials can withstand high temperatures and resist combustion, providing an additional layer of protection. Manufacturers often utilize materials like fire-retardant plastics in battery construction.
-
Certification Marks (e.g., CE, UL): Certification marks indicate that a battery has met specific safety and performance standards. CE marking signifies compliance with European safety directives, while UL certification is recognized in the United States. Selecting certified products assures users of quality and safety.
These safety features are critical considerations when choosing a replacement battery for the Dyson SV10. They help ensure user safety and efficient performance.

How Can You Ensure Compatibility When Purchasing a Replacement Battery for Dyson SV10?
To ensure compatibility when purchasing a replacement battery for the Dyson SV10, you should verify specific battery specifications, consider the manufacturer’s recommendations, and check customer reviews.
-
Battery Specifications: Ensure the replacement battery matches the original battery’s specifications. Look for:
– Voltage: The OEM battery typically operates at 21.6V. A compatible battery should have the same voltage to function correctly.
– Capacity: Look for capacity in amp-hours (Ah) or milliamp-hours (mAh). Higher capacity batteries offer longer runtime.
– Connector Type: The battery should have the same connector type to ensure proper installation. -
Manufacturer’s Recommendations: Purchase batteries from reputable brands that comply with Dyson specifications. Consider:
– Compatibility: Brands may specify which models are compatible with their batteries. Check if the battery states it is suitable for the Dyson SV10.
– Warranty: A good warranty indicates trust in the product’s quality and can provide protection against defects. -
Customer Reviews: Reading customer feedback can provide insights into the performance and reliability of the battery. Focus on:
– Performance Ratings: Look for mentions of battery life and charging speed in user reviews.
– Installation Experiences: Customers often share their installation experiences, which can indicate ease of replacement and overall compatibility.
By following these steps, you can increase your chances of choosing a suitable replacement battery for your Dyson SV10, ensuring optimal performance and longevity.
What Signs Indicate an Incompatible Battery for the Dyson SV10?
Signs that indicate an incompatible battery for the Dyson SV10 include physical mismatches and performance issues.
- Battery size does not fit in the compartment.
- Battery terminals do not align with connectors.
- Battery voltage differs from the required voltage.
- Charger is not compatible or does not fit.
- Rapid loss of power during use.
- LED lights (if equipped) indicate battery faults.
- Unusual noises when the battery is installed.
- Battery has visible damage or wear.
These signs provide insight into issues that may arise when using the incorrect battery type. Understanding these indicators can help users determine the battery’s compatibility effectively.
-
Battery Size Mismatch:
Battery size mismatch occurs when the dimensions of the battery do not fit properly into the SV10 vacuum. The Dyson SV10 requires a specific size for stability and secure attachment. If a replacement battery does not fit snugly, it may not function correctly. -
Terminal Misalignment:
Terminal misalignment happens when the battery’s electrical contacts do not line up with the vacuum’s connectors. This misalignment can prevent the battery from providing proper power supply to the device. -
Voltage Difference:
Voltage difference refers to when the voltage rating of the replacement battery is higher or lower than the required 21.6 volts for the Dyson SV10. Using a battery with the wrong voltage can lead to poor performance or even damage the vacuum. -
Incompatible Charger:
Incompatible charger issues arise when the charging device does not fit the battery or is not designed to supply the necessary power. Using the incorrect charger can also impact battery life and safety. -
Rapid Power Loss:
Rapid power loss indicates that the vacuum may struggle to maintain suction. This issue can often be a sign of an incompatible or degrading battery. Inadequate battery performance could lead to intermittent power loss during operation. -
LED Indicator Faults:
If the battery is equipped with LED indicators, flashing lights or constant warnings can signal battery faults. These indicators are programmed to alert users about battery health and compatibility. -
Unusual Noises:
Unusual noises may emerge when a battery does not function correctly within the vacuum. These sounds could indicate improper contact or internal issues due to incompatibility. -
Visible Damage:
Visible damage, such as cracks or leaks, on the battery can render it incompatible. Damaged batteries can also pose safety risks and should be replaced immediately.
Recognizing these signs helps users avoid purchasing or using batteries that are not compatible with their Dyson SV10, ensuring optimal performance and safety.
